How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 83702?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 83702 Studio Apartments | $1,435 | $1,149 | $2,300 |
| 83702 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,322 | $975 | $3,550 |
| 83702 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,995 | $1,195 | $6,320 |
| 83702 3 Bedroom Apartments | $5,148 | $2,325 | $9,075 |
| 83702 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,070 | $899 | $2,098 |
